Structural Concrete Design
Subject
ENCI - Civil Engineering
Description
Structural systems for buildings. Flexural design in reinforced concrete. Design of continuous beams and one-way slabs using moment coefficients. Shear design. Bond and development. Serviceability. Two-way slab and flat plate systems: direct design method, punching shear. Biaxially loaded and long columns. Walls: laterally loaded walls, bearing walls, shear walls. Footings: wall footings, isolated footings. Pre-stressed concrete: introduction and elastic analysis. Use of computer programs where applicable.
Prerequisite(s): Civil Engineering 451.
Corequisite(s): Civil Engineering 551.
